    Porsche 959: A Technological Marvel

    When it comes to technological innovation, the Porsche 959 stands head and shoulders above the rest. This groundbreaking supercar, produced in the late 1980s, was a showcase of Porsche's engineering prowess. It boasted features like electronically controlled all-wheel drive, adjustable suspension, and a twin-turbocharged engine that produced staggering performance for its time. The 959 was not only incredibly fast but also remarkably sophisticated, setting a new standard for what a sports car could be.     Porsche Carrera GT: The Analog Supercar

    For those who crave a raw, unfiltered driving experience, the Porsche Carrera GT is the holy grail. This V10-powered masterpiece is a symphony of mechanical precision, offering unparalleled connection between driver and machine. With its lightweight construction, manual transmission, and naturally aspirated engine, the Carrera GT delivers a visceral thrill that few cars can match. The Carrera GT is not for the faint of heart; it demands respect and rewards skillful driving with an unforgettable experience.     Porsche 918 Spyder: The Hybrid Hypercar

    Representing the future of Porsche performance, the 918 Spyder is a revolutionary hybrid hypercar that combines blistering speed with cutting-edge technology. Its plug-in hybrid powertrain delivers incredible power and torque, while its advanced aerodynamics and lightweight construction ensure breathtaking handling. The 918 Spyder is not just a fast car; it's a technological tour de force, showcasing Porsche's commitment to innovation and sustainability.
